U.S. Special Representative for Afghanistan and Pakistan Ambassador Marc Grossman is traveling to Copenhagen, Oslo, Stockholm, Warsaw, the Hague, Berlin, Paris, and Brussels March 18-24, 2012.
Ambassador Grossman is traveling through Europe to consult with our NATO Allies and Partners in advance of the NATO summit in Chicago in May. In the lead up to the summit, we are focused on how best to support sustainable and sufficient Afghan National Security Forces for Afghanistan’s future and how we can further strengthen the NATO-Afghanistan Enduring Partnership. Chicago will therefore be a critical milestone in our effort in Afghanistan, as leaders come together to discuss transition and the future of our support for Afghanistan and its security forces. Ambassador Grossman also will participate in the Brussels Forum.
